“DNA Fingerprinting at the NOVA Lab”
What does a restriction enzyme do?
They cut the DNA molecules at different locations like scissors.
What is agarose gel?
Agarose gel is a thick, porous, jello-like substance. It acts as a molecular strainer, allowing smaller pieces of DNA to move through more easily than larger pieces.
What is electrophoresis?
The process of moving molecules with an electric current.
Smaller fragments of DNA move ____________ than longer strands?
Easier
Why do you need to place a nylon membrane over the gel?
The agarose gel is difficult to work with.
Probes attach themselves to __________.
DNA Fragments on the nylon membrane.
